CVE-2026-9213

UNKNOWN 0.0

Insufficient input validation in certain NETGEAR routers

A vulnerability in the affected NETGEAR gaming routers allows attackers with the ability to intercept and tamper with traffic between the router and the Internet, to execute code on the device.

CWE CWE-20

Affected Versions

NETGEAR / MR70
0 < V1.0.4.48
NETGEAR / MS70
0 < V1.0.4.48
NETGEAR / RAXE500
0 < V1.2.14.114
NETGEAR / XR1000
0 < V1.0.2.86
